Amongst A very powerful rituals for the duration of this time may be the darshan (viewing) of the idol. Devotees stand in very long queues, often for over 24 hours, just to acquire a glimpse of Lalbaugcha Raja. There are two key queues for darshan: the “Navsachi Line,” in which devotees seek blessings for their needs to generally be fulfilled, as well as the “Mukh Darshan Line,” which is for standard viewing.

The Navsachi line is for those who want to get their wishes fulfilled. Pilgrims go on the phase, contact the ft on the idol, and receives the blessings of Ganesha.

In Assam, the dhol is extensively Employed in Rongali Bihu (Bohag Bihu), the Assamese new yr celebrations during the month of April. Celebrated in mid-April each year (ordinarily on 14 or thirteen April in accordance with the Assamese traditional calendar), the dhol is an important and a quintessential instrument Utilized in Bihu dance. The origin with the Dhol in Assam dates again to at least the 14th century when it had been referred in Assamese Buranjis as getting performed from the indigenous men and women. This shows which the origin of Dhol in Assam was Significantly older than the remainder of India, and also the name was in all probability because of sanskritisation.
